Because of a missing check member attributes (for use with action: member)
are cleared when a non-member attribute is changed. The fix simply adds a
check for None (parameter not set) to gen_add_del_lists in
ansible_freeipa_module to make sure that the parameter is only changed if
it should be changed.
All places where the add and removal lists have been generated manually
have been changed to also use gen_add_del_lists.
Resolves: #252 (The "Manager" attribute is removed when updating any user
attribute)
In the case that the admin password has been set and become was not set
the call to backend.connect in api_connect failed. The solution is simply
to set os.environ["KRB5CCNAME"] in temp_kinit after kinit_password has
been called using the temporary ccache. os.environ["KRB5CCNAME"] is not
used automatically by api.Backend.[ldap2,rpcclient].connect. Afterwards
os.environ["KRB5CCNAME"] is unset in temp_kdestroy if ccache_name is not
None.
Fixes: #249 (Kerberos errors while using the modules with a non-sudoer user)

The use of "default: idstart+199999" in the description of the idmax
parameter was resulting in the galaxy import error:
Cannot parse "DOCUMENTATION": mapping values are not allowed here in
"<unicode string>", line 52, column 58: ... value for the IDs range
(default: idstart+199999)
The ":" has simply been removed to fix this issue.

The import of ansible_ipa_server, ansible_ipa_replica and ansible_ipa_client
might result in a permission denied error for the log file. It seems that
for collections the module utils seem to be loaded before the needed
permissions are aquired now.
The fix simply adds a wrapper for standard_logging_setup that is called in
all the modules of the server, replica and client roles to do the loggin
setup as one of the first steps of the module execution and not before.
Due to setting aaaa_extra_create_reverse or a_extra_create_reverse when not
needed, host module fails to add a host with reverse address. This patch
fixes the behavior by only adding *_extra_create_reverse when needed.
